Showing 36 of 694 projects
A command-line interface for managing Cloudflare DNS, zones, caching, and security settings.
Convert ttyrec terminal recordings into animated GIFs for easy sharing and demonstration.
A command-line tool for creating and accessing text snippets, serving as your personal wiki in the terminal.
Converts Java Flight Recorder method profiling samples into FlameGraph-compatible stack traces for performance analysis.
A simple command-line script to manage macOS GateKeeper settings, enabling, disabling, and removing app quarantines.
A bash parser for semantic versioning that helps manage project versions from Makefiles or scripts.
A top-like command-line tool for real-time monitoring of Erlang nodes, showing process and system metrics.
A command-line tool to retrieve and print device location data using macOS CoreLocation services.
A command-line utility for creating GitLab merge requests and performing common GitLab operations directly from the terminal.
A 36K single-binary tool that runs commands in parallel and waits for their termination with minimal memory footprint.
A greedy path planning tool that optimizes SVG files for more efficient pen plotting by sorting drawing paths.
A fuzzy search tool for Nix packages, options, and modules that integrates with fuzzy finders like fzf and television.
A command-line tool for converting currency rates directly in your terminal.
A simple CSS parser and inliner library written in Go for processing and embedding styles in HTML.
A POSIX shell script that splits audio images with CUE sheets into separate tracks with tagging and cover art.
A flexible command-line client for interacting with Arch Linux's User Repository (AUR).
A command-line tool for orchestrating Apache Cassandra cluster operations with topology-aware parallel execution.
A Ruby gem that automatically manages SSH config entries for AWS EC2 instances using instance tags.
A terminal tool that displays test coverage for Go source files with color-coded output.
A Rust tool for drawing low-resolution graphs directly in the terminal for quick data analysis from logs and text files.
A high-efficiency 2D bin packing tool for creating texture atlases using the MaxRects algorithm with aggressive heuristics.
A minimal implementation of the UNIX tree command with colors, file-size reporting, and pattern matching.
A command-line tool for managing project-specific command aliases with before/after hooks and quiet mode.
A lightweight version manager for the Crystal programming language, inspired by rbenv.
A shell command hook for Claude Code that auto-approves safe commands and blocks destructive ones to reduce permission fatigue.
A Go tool that enforces minimum test coverage thresholds locally and in CI, ensuring code quality and preventing coverage regressions.
A command-line tool for querying and transforming JSON/NDJSON documents using the GROQ query language.
An OCaml library for reading, writing, and modifying PDF files, serving as the foundation for the CPDF toolchain.
A command-line tool for macOS persistence mechanism emulation, designed for threat hunters and security testing.
A PowerShell module for creating, editing, splitting, merging, and converting PDF files across Windows, Linux, and macOS.
A command-line tool for macOS persistence mechanism emulation and testing, designed for threat hunters.
An efficient command-line tool and library for filtering duplicate lines from textual input, optimized for speed and memory usage.
A concise language for sketching ASCII art using a Python-based REPL and directional printing.
A command-line tool to search and display GIFs directly in your terminal using the Giphy API.
A read-only command-line browser for exploring Kafka topics, partitions, and messages with search and custom decoding.
A command-line tool that merges multiple pcap files while gracefully handling corrupt or malformed input.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.